Nepse surges by 9. 23 points on Thursday

The Nepal Stock Exchange (NEPSE) gained 9. 23 points to close at 2, 714. 61 points on Thursday. 

The sensitive index, however, dropped by 0. 47 points to close at 465. 42 points.

A total of 19,075,756-unit shares of 332 companies were traded for Rs 1. 55 billion.

Meanwhile, SY Panel Nepal Limited (SYPNL), Shreenagar Agritech Industries Limited (SAIL) and Trishuli Jal Vidhyut Company Limited (TVCL) were the top gainers today, with their price surging by 10. 00 percent. 

Likewise,  Kalika power Company Ltd (KPCL) was the top loser as its price fell by 6. 25 percent.

At the end of the day, total market capitalization stood at Rs 4. 55 trillion.
